Buy a Guthrie’s Franchise

Guthrie’s is a fast‑casual, franchise‑friendly chicken‑focused restaurant chain founded in 1965 in Haleyville, Alabama, and widely recognized as the original chicken fingers concept. The menu centers on hand‑tossed chicken fingers, signature sauces, fries, coleslaw, and Texas toast, giving franchisees a simple, craveable, and easily repeatable day‑part menu for lunch, dinner, and catering. With over 70 locations across the U.S. and a push into new markets, Guthrie’s blends a heritage Southern‑style brand with a relatively streamlined real‑estate model that targets convenient in‑line and strip‑center spaces.

Guthrie’s Franchise Costs & Information

  • Minimum Qualifications

    • Initial Franchise Fee

      $35,000 per restaurant

    • Initial Investment

      $231,050 – $569,200

    • Cash Requirement

      $75,000 minimum

  • Royalty

    • Royalty Fee

      5%

      of gross sales
